Qatar grants landing visa privileges to Taiwanese tourists

Taipei, June 27 (CNA) Qatar has recently decided to grant landing visa privileges to Taiwanese passport holders who visit the Gulf country for tourism, Taiwan's Ministry of Foreign Affairs said Tuesday.

The move allows Taiwanese passport holders to visit Qatar and stay there for up to 30 days with a landing visa, the ministry said.

The new measure came after Taiwan began granting e-visas to Qatar citizens last October, the ministry said, adding that these reciprocal initiatives are expected to help promote bilateral exchanges in trade, tourism and culture.

Taiwanese passport holders are required to have a passport valid for at least six months, a return or transfer flight ticket, accommodation booking records and a financial statement when applying for a landing visa upon arrival in Qatar, the ministry said.

The fee for the landing visa is about US$30, it added.

Taiwanese passport holders currently enjoy visa-free entry, landing visas or e-visas for more than 160 countries and territories.
